Szpakowska et al. also examined conolidone and its action around the ACKR3 receptor, which aids to explain its Formerly mysterious mechanism of action in the two acute and Serious pain Handle (fifty eight). It was found that receptor amounts of ACKR3 were being as substantial or simply better as These on the endogenous opiate system and were being correlated to very similar regions of the CNS. This receptor was also not modulated by common opiate agonists, including morphine, fentanyl, buprenorphine, or antagonists like naloxone. Inside of a rat model, it had been discovered that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ory activity, resulting in an overall rise in opiate receptor exercise.

Conolidine’s molecular construction is often a testomony to its exceptional pharmacological prospective, characterized by a fancy framework falling beneath monoterpenoid indole alkaloids. This construction options an indole Main, a bicyclic ring technique comprising a six-membered benzene ring fused to your 5-membered nitrogen-made up of pyrrole ring.
These practical groups determine conolidine’s chemical id and pharmacokinetic Attributes. The tertiary amine performs a crucial role within the compound’s power to penetrate mobile membranes, impacting bioavailability.
